What is a debt collection lawsuit in Dubai?
A debt collection lawsuit in Dubai is a legal process initiated when a creditor seeks to recover unpaid debts from a debtor through the courts. In the UAE, debt collection is regulated by federal laws and the procedures followed in the courts of Dubai. Creditors may resort to filing a lawsuit when all other avenues, such as amicable settlements or out-of-court negotiations, have failed.
In Dubai, the process begins with a formal demand for payment issued to the debtor. If the debtor fails to respond or settle the amount within the specified period, the creditor can escalate the matter by filing a case in the Dubai Courts. The court system in Dubai is known for its efficiency, and it provides a structured platform for resolving debt collection Dubai.
Once the case is filed, the court will summon the debtor to appear and provide a defense. If the debtor fails to respond or cannot provide a valid defense, the court may issue a judgment in favor of the creditor. This judgment allows the creditor to take further legal action to enforce the debt, which could include the freezing of assets, garnishment of wages, or even the seizure of property. Debt collection in Dubai follows strict procedures to ensure fairness to both parties, providing creditors with legal means to recover debts while protecting debtors from unjust claims.
